Bush And AIDS

By The Daily Dish
Dec 9 2008, 8:08 AM ET

by Chris Bodenner
Mona Charen calls out liberals for not giving credit where credit's due:

Motivated perhaps by his deeply felt Christian faith (relieving poverty in Africa has become a major charitable push among evangelicals), the president has pressed for greater aid to Africa across the board. The original PEPFAR legislation ... was the largest single health investment by any government ever ($15 billion). ... In July of this year, the president requested that funding for PEPFAR be doubled to $30 billion.

Of course the left can say whatever they like about George Bush and the war in Iraq and the war on terror. But when he does something completely in line with their own stated principles and values, it is simply mean-spirited of them to deny him his due.
